Is it possible to select the whole folder in VB.NET open dialog box?

By this I mean, open the dialog box and navigate through the folder and then select an entire folder not an individual file.

    You can’t select a folder with the OpenFileDialog. You can select a folder with the FolderBrowserDialog.

    Are you looking to select all the files in a folder? If so, use a FolderBrowserDialog to allow users to select a folder and call code similar to the following:

    Dim files As String() = Directory.GetDirectories(folderBrowserDialog1.SelectedPath) 
    

    You can also go ahead and use an OpenFileDialog and set its Multiselect property to true. This will allow your users the select more than one file in the dialog.
